Output 76f940e81f105a6371f74d99705533ceb7c6f8e17391b7eace5d8c5202af741f:9

value
29676027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4359a2debcd06e24805fe05740abc291f8533bc3 OP_EQUAL
address
ME3GtKHAJeucs8tW1Uv5YzEM2LpuAoJfMQ
transaction
76f940e81f105a6371f74d99705533ceb7c6f8e17391b7eace5d8c5202af741f
spent
true